The difference in rainfall between the wettest and driest months can vary significantly depending on the region. In tropical areas, the wettest month might receive over 300 mm of rain, while the driest could see less than 10 mm, resulting in a difference of around 290 mm or more. In temperate regions, the disparity may be less pronounced, with wet months averaging 100 mm and dry months around 20 mm, leading to a difference of about 80 mm. Overall, the variation reflects local climate patterns and seasonal changes.

The wettest months on Mount Kilimanjaro are typically April, May, and November. These months tend to have heavier rainfall and are considered the "long rainy season" and "short rainy season" on the mountain. It is important for climbers to consider these weather patterns when planning their ascent.

The wettest season in St. Louis is typically spring, particularly in the months of May and June. This is when the city experiences the most rainfall and thunderstorms.

The wettest month in California varies by region, but typically the wettest months are December through February due to the winter storm season. However, parts of Southern California may experience more precipitation in January and February compared to December.
